Yûya Uchida, a renowned Japanese actor, first took his first breath on December 3, 1965, in the Saitama Prefecture of Japan. With a career spanning multiple decades, he has made a significant impact in the entertainment industry, captivating audiences with his exceptional acting skills. Some of his most notable roles include the iconic characters from the popular anime series Soul Eater, released in 2008, Naruto: Shippuden, which premiered in 2007, and Devil May Cry 4, a highly acclaimed video game, also released in 2008.
